1. 程式人生 > >Windows Server 2008共享資源設定步驟詳解

Windows Server 2008共享資源設定步驟詳解

      很多人認為訪問共享資源很簡單,只要先找到共享資源,之後雙擊共享目標,再登入進去就可以進行訪問操作了。事實上,這其中的每一步操作都可能會受到Windows系統的限制;這不,當我們嘗試訪問Windows Server 2008系統中的共享資源時,該系統就對其中的每一個環節設定了障礙,我們必須對症下藥進行合理設定,才能掃清障礙,讓共享訪問一路綠燈。

  1、掃清看不見障礙

  按理來說,從區域網中的普通計算機中,開啟網路上的芳鄰視窗就能看到目標共享資源了;可是,Windows Server 2008系統中的共享資源卻不是那麼容易見到的,這是為什麼呢?原來,Windows Server 2008系統在預設狀態下強化了安全效能,它通過新增加的網路發現功能控制著普通客戶端隨意檢視儲存在其中的目標共享資源。因此,當我們無法從網路上的芳鄰視窗中檢視到Windows Server 2008系統中的目標共享資源時,那需要檢查對應系統的網路發現功能是否正常開啟了,下面就是具體的檢視步驟:

  首先開啟Windows Server 2008系統的“開始”選單,從中依次選擇“設定”/“控制面板”命令,在其後的控制面板視窗中用滑鼠雙擊“網路和共享中心”圖示,開啟對應系統的網路和共享中心管理視窗;

  其次從該管理視窗的“共享和發現”列表下面,找到“網路發現”選項,再展開該選項設定區域(如圖1所示),檢查在預設狀態下“啟用網路發現”選項是否處於選中狀態,如果發現該選項還沒有選中時,那就說明Windows Server 2008系統禁止區域網中的任何使用者通過網路檢視、訪問其中的所有共享資源,這麼一來我們自然就不能看到其中的目標共享資源了;

  此時,我們可以選中“啟用網路發現”選項,再單擊“應用”按鈕儲存好上述設定操作。當然,在這裡我們必須確保“檔案共享”選項也處於選中狀態,不然的話Windows Server 2008系統是不能將目標資源共享釋出到區域網網路中的。

  當然,還有一點需要各位朋友注意的是,區域網中的普通計算機一定要和Windows Server 2008系統所在主機位於相同的工作子網中,並且它們要使用相同的工作組名稱,如果連這個條件都不能保證,那我們或許根本就看不到目標共享資源所在主機的“身影”,更不要談去訪問它了。

    2、掃清打不開障礙

  在網路上的芳鄰視窗中看到Windows Server 2008系統中的目標共享資源後,那說明目標共享資源已經在向我們“招手”了,但是能不能和它握上手,這還不一定呢,這是因為當我們嘗試用滑鼠雙擊目標共享資源圖示時,經常會遭遇類似禁止訪問、找不到網路路徑等現象的打不開障礙。不同的現象引起的原因也不同,我們需要依照具體的現象依次排查,才能掃清目標共享資源打不開的障礙。

  一般來說,當我們用滑鼠雙擊目標共享資源圖示時,Windows Server 2008系統會先對共享訪問操作進行身份驗證,驗證通過之後才會判斷是否有權訪問,最後才決定是否要將目標共享資源內容顯示出來。依照這個共享訪問過程,我們不難得出當系統出現禁止訪問的提示現象時,那很可能是Windows Server 2008系統不允許使用者通過網路訪問共享資源,或者訪問使用者不具有訪問許可權,此時我們可以按照下面的步驟進行排查:

  首先在Windows Server 2008系統桌面中依次單擊“開始”/“執行”命令,在彈出的系統執行框中,執行字串命令“gpedit.msc”,開啟對應系統的組策略控制檯視窗,在該視窗左側顯示窗格中點選“計算機配置”節點選項,並從該節點下面依次展開“Windows設定”/“安全設定”/“本地策略”/“使用者許可權分配”組策略分支;

  其次在目標分支下面雙擊“從網路訪問此計算機”選項,當系統螢幕上出現如圖2所示的設定對話方塊時,我們仔細檢查一下“本地安全設定”設定頁面中,是否存在自己使用的共享訪問賬號;例如,當我們預設以“Guest”賬號進行共享訪問操作時,如果“Guest”賬號沒有出現在圖2所示的設定對話方塊中時,那系統就會出現禁止訪問的提示,此時我們只要單擊“新增”按鈕,將自己使用的共享訪問賬號新增進來就可以了。

    如果自己使用的共享訪問賬號沒有設定密碼時,我們也有可能會遇到禁止訪問的故障提示,這是因為Windows Server 2008系統在預設狀態下只允許空白密碼賬號訪問控制檯操作,而不允許他們進行其他任何操作;為此,我們還需要檢視Windows Server 2008系統的相關組策略引數,看看它是否對空白密碼賬號的訪問操作進行了限制:

  首先開啟Windows Server 2008系統的執行對話方塊,在其中輸入“gpedit.msc”字串命令,單擊回車鍵後,進入對應系統的組策略控制檯視窗,在該視窗左側顯示窗格中點選“計算機配置”節點選項,並從該節點下面依次展開“Windows設定”/“安全設定”/“本地策略”/“安全選項”組策略分支;

  其次在對應“安全選項”組策略分支的右側顯示區域中,用滑鼠雙擊“賬戶:使用空白密碼的本地賬戶只允許進行控制檯登入”目標組策略,開啟如圖3所示的設定對話方塊,要是看到其中的“已啟用”選項處於選中狀態時,那就說明Windows Server 2008系統禁止空白使用者賬號進行共享訪問操作,此時我們必須選中“已禁用”選項,再單擊“確定”按鈕儲存好上述設定操作。

  經過上述設定操作,要是系統螢幕上還出現找不到網路路徑等故障提示時,那我們可以嘗試重新整理一下客戶端系統中的網路上的芳鄰視窗,以防止Windows Server 2008系統中的目標共享資源位置真的發生了變化,如果執行過重新整理操作之後,該故障提示仍然不消失的話,那很可能是Windows Server 2008系統中的隱藏共享IPC$被意外關閉運行了,因為共享內容能否顯示出來需要IPC$的支援,如果得不到它的支援,那麼系統就會提示說找不到目標共享資源的網路路徑。在檢查Windows Server 2008系統中的隱藏共享IPC$是否啟用正常時,我們可以按照下面的步驟來進行:

  首先單擊Windows Server 2008系統桌面中的“開始”按鈕,從彈出的“開始”選單中依次點選“程式”/“附件”/“命令提示符”選項,再用滑鼠右鍵單擊“命令提示符”選項,然後執行“以管理員身份執行”命令,將系統螢幕切換到DOS命令列工作視窗;

  其次在該視窗的命令列提示符下輸入字串命令“net share”,單擊回車鍵後,我們就能從其後的結果介面中看到隱藏共享IPC$的啟用狀態了,要是發現它執行不正常時,我們只要簡單地執行一下字串命令“net share IPC$”就可以了。

    3、掃清登不進障礙

    有的時候,我們雙擊Windows Server 2008系統中的目標共享資源圖示後,系統螢幕上會出現一個身份驗證對話方塊,按理來說,只要正確地輸入共享訪問賬號,就能開啟目標共享資源的資料夾視窗,並能進行共享訪問操作了。可是,在實際訪問Windows Server 2008系統中的共享資源時,我們有時會遭遇這樣一則奇怪的故障現象,那就是無論輸入什麼共享訪問賬號,Windows Server 2008系統總提示說無法登入成功;面對這樣的共享訪問障礙,我們該如何才能將它掃除掉呢?

  大家知道,在進行共享訪問操作時,Windows客戶端系統會自動優先以“Guest”帳號進行登入,如果登入不成功時,系統就會自動出現身份驗證對話方塊,要求我們使用其他合適的使用者賬號進行共享登入。現在,系統螢幕上出現了身份驗證對話方塊,那說明“Guest”帳號沒有通過Windows Server 2008系統的身份驗證操作,此時我們只要輸入合適的其他使用者賬號,往往就能登入進Windows Server 2008系統了;可是,這裡又出現了無論輸入什麼賬號又登入不進的奇怪現象,這又是什麼原因呢?其實很簡單,Windows Server 2008系統支援兩種共享訪問模式,一種是簡單訪問模式,一種是高階訪問模式,如果啟用了簡單訪問模式的話,Windows Server 2008系統就不會對任何共享使用者進行身份驗證;相反,要是選用了高階訪問模式,那麼Windows Server 2008系統就會強行對任何使用者進行共享身份驗證,“Guest”帳號自然也不例外。很明顯,在這裡Windows Server 2008系統使用了高階訪問模式,在這種訪問模式下,它會強行要求“Guest”帳號輸入共享訪問密碼,事實上“Guest”帳號在預設狀態下並沒有設定密碼,這麼一來就出現了我們無論輸入什麼共享訪問密碼也不能成功登入的奇怪故障了。弄清楚了故障原因,那麼我們只要將Windows Server 2008系統的共享訪問模式改變一下就可以了:

  首先開啟Windows Server 2008系統的執行對話方塊,在其中輸入“gpedit.msc”字串命令,單擊回車鍵後,進入對應系統的組策略控制檯視窗,在該視窗左側顯示窗格中點選“計算機配置”節點選項,並從該節點下面依次展開“Windows設定”/“安全設定”/“本地策略”/“安全選項”組策略分支;

  其次在目標分支下面找到“網路訪問:本地帳戶的共享和安全模式”選項,並用滑鼠右鍵單擊該選項,執行快捷選單中的“屬性”命令,開啟如圖4所示的目標組策略屬性視窗,將該視窗中的“僅來賓——本地使用者以來賓身份驗證”專案選中,再單擊“確定”按鈕儲存好設定操作,這樣的話就能解決好上述的故障現象了。

  當然,為了安全考慮,我們最好關閉Windows Server 2008系統的“Guest”帳號,讓系統仍然使用高階訪問模式,同時在Windows Server 2008系統中建立一個可以正常訪問共享資源的使用者賬號,日後我們只要使用新建立的使用者賬號進行共享登入就可以了,這樣可以防止非法使用者隨意訪問目標共享資源